Cramps are actually abnormal contractions of muscles which may occur in various parts of the body. Muscles naturally contract as a means of facilitating movement. However, muscles function in such as way that its contraction and relaxation happen simultaneously at differing rates depending on the speed of movements made. Cramps happen when a muscle or group of muscles contract for a long period of time without being able to relax alternately. The prolonged contracted state of the muscle causes it to feel fatigued and painful. Some muscle cramps last only for a few seconds or minutes while certain health conditions such as tetanus may cause a muscle to cramp for hours.
Muscle cramps happen due to various reasons. Some studies conducted previously had indicated the influence of diabetes, being flat-footed, prolonged sitting, and dehydration as possible reasons for having muscle cramps. Medications such as diuretics may cause certain electrolytes and nutrients to deplete rapidly from a person’s body which in turn can result to muscle cramping. Basically, to avoid having muscle cramps, these causes should be avoided or eliminated.

Still, a lot more new details were added to my knowledge. They told me that some studies had indicated the benefit of stretching and regular exercise included prevention of muscle cramps. Drinking more fluids especially during rigorous activities and using comfortable footwear that support the natural arch of the feet also helped prevent cramping. According to them, medications are supposed to be a person’s last resort, if that is still possible.
